Modeling seed dispersal distances: implications for transgenic Pinus taeda

Summary

Predicting seed dispersal from transgenic trees is crucial for gene flow and biocontainment. Most seeds fall locally, but long-distance dispersal (LDD) can exceed 1 km, posing a risk for genetically engineered forest trees.
